Maroon Struggle in Colombia

The struggle for freedom was an historical constant among Black people; the history of the Colombian national struggle for freedom drew inspiration from Black people's efforts to gain liberty. To meet their objective, African slaves enacted different forms of resistance, such as going on hunger strikes,jumping overboard from slave ships on the voyage to the Americas, committing suicide and infanticide, poisoning Spaniards, running away from plantations and into the forests and directly confronting colonists.
